2024 National Holiday Observance

The Bulloch County Branch of the NAACP cordially invites you to be our honored guest at the 2024 National Holiday Observance parade on Monday, January 15, 2024 which commemorates the life and legacy of the late Reverend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r.  In remembering the work of Dr. King, we display the very best of America in terms of our strength and endurance to overcome and succeed.


Honoring the legacy of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. is not only for celebration and remembrance, education and tribute, but above all a time of service. It is a time of interracial and intercultural cooperation and sharing. No other time of the year brings so many people from different cultural backgrounds together in such a vibrant spirit of brother and sisterhood. This year the theme is "Thrive: In Movement. In Culture. In Community". Your presence during this special event would mean so much to the success of this noble endeavor. 


The parade will be held at 2p.m. in downtown Statesboro, GA featuring elected officials, marching bands, community organizations, businesses, colorful floats and much more.
